Output eddd0656f9ea29ebb76240e103e7675cd843e067411ac21798c7286f66f14451:3

value
8917705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9e03f384703bebed3813837fd04695fa09f0932 OP_EQUAL
address
MWgP89W1sq4Ww2X5uoHhqb1ekVY6EouNdF
transaction
eddd0656f9ea29ebb76240e103e7675cd843e067411ac21798c7286f66f14451
spent
true